St. Joseph Villas Homecare and Hospice, a premier Home Health and Hospice company in Omaha, Nebraska, has an opportunity for a Clinical Manager.

Job duties include:

  • Manage staff compliance with regulatory expectations
  • Audit patient records for ongoing monitoring of documentation compliance
  • Perform accurate and timely clinical reviews to meet deadlines
  • Compile, review, analyze and graph audit data
  • Maintain quality data and reports
  • Work with hospice staff to follow up on audit results
  • Collaborate with clinical team to identify performance improvement/QAPI issues and staff educational needs
  • Coordinate and execute staff education as it relates to above

Requirements:

Requirements

  • Experience in Hospice required
  • Must have attention to detail resulting in accurate outcomes
  • Excellent interpersonal, written and oral communication skills with a professional attitude, demeanor and appearance
  • May be required to provide direct patient care assuming staff nurse responsibilities when necessary to support safe, high-quality patient care and agency operation
  • Proficient computer skills, including Word and Excel
